Tattoos on the Heart

If you’re from Los Angeles, chances are you’ve seen countless news stories about gang violence and activity. One Jesuit priest, Father Gregory Boyle, has devoted decades of his life to gang intervention in Los Angeles, the so called “gang capitol of the world.” Father Boyle founded Homeboy Industries in 1986 to offer support, job training, tattoo removal, and rehabilitation to gang members around the greater Los Angeles area. Today, Homeboy Industries is the largest gang intervention program in the country. In his new book, Tattoos on the Heart, Father Boyle offers first hand accounts of some of his interactions with “the homies” and “homegirls” and the lessons and miracles he’s encountered through the years.
